Halsted Market Days — known locally as Market Days — is the premier summer street festival of Chicago's Boystown neighbourhood, held annually in August. The festival stretches along Halsted Street between Belmont and Addison, transforming the street into a two-day open-air event with multiple stages, food and drink vendors, merchandise stalls, and performances spanning pop, drag, dance, and live acts. Market Days draws approximately 75,000 to 80,000 people over its two-day run and is the second-largest LGBTQ+ event in Chicago after the Pride Parade. The festival has been running for over 30 years and is organised by the Northalsted Business Alliance. It is a distinctly community-oriented event: the bars along Halsted open their patios and run outdoor areas, the Center on Halsted is a hub of activity, and the atmosphere is the specific combination of summer heat, cold beer, and neighbourhood pride that makes it unlike any equivalent event in another American city.
